Given a positive integer num, write a function which returns True if num is a perfect square else False.
Note: Do not use any built-in library function such as
sqrt
.
Example 1:
Input: 16 Returns: True
Example 2:
Input: 14 Returns: FalseAnalysis:
Be careful with int/int, if num is 5, 5/2=2.
Solution:
To include 1, use start <= end as while condition. Easy but not trivial.
class Solution { public boolean isPerfectSquare(int num) { long start = 1, end = num; while (start <= end) { long mid = start + (end -start) / 2; if (mid * mid == num) return true; else if (mid * mid < num) { start = mid + 1; } else { end = mid - 1; } } return false; } }
